		<description>Tonya #124
You are correct.
They are supposed to print the ECBs after they ring up the items (at the sale price).  It is a separate, manual transaction.  The lower portion of the raincheck has a code for the cashier to enter.  Below that it states &quot;Extra Bucks will be issued upon Raincheck redemption&quot;. Maybe you can go back and talk to the manager to correct and reissue your ECBs. Hope this helps you get the ECBs you are due :)</description>

		<description>Tonya -

You are correct.   You should have received the ECB&#039;s.  I&#039;ve done this for the past 3 weeks with no problems.  I would call/ email CVS and they will most likely correct it for you.

For future reference - the cashier will have to &quot;force&quot; the ECB&#039;s after your transaction including the raincheck is finished.  For example, I used my raincheck for the Grip Pens $.99 w. $.99 ECB.  I paid for the pens and then after the transaction was finished, the clerk scanned the receipt and forced the ECBs for the raincheck.  

I&#039;ve done this a two different CVS stores.</description>
